The Core Functions of Data Analytics Software

Data analytics software is designed to process large volumes of data, providing users with the ability to analyze and interpret complex data sets. The core functions typically include data collection, processing, visualization, and reporting. These tools enable organizations to:

  • Collect data from various sources, ensuring comprehensive data coverage.
  • Process and clean data to enhance accuracy and reliability.
  • Visualize data through charts, graphs, and dashboards for easy interpretation.
  • Generate detailed reports to support decision-making processes.

By automating these functions, data analytics software reduces the time and effort required to extract valuable insights, allowing businesses to focus on strategic initiatives.

Applications Across Industries

The versatility of data analytics software makes it applicable across a wide range of industries. In healthcare, for instance, it is used to improve patient outcomes by analyzing treatment effectiveness and predicting disease outbreaks. In finance, analytics tools help in risk management and fraud detection by analyzing transaction patterns. Retail businesses leverage data analytics to optimize inventory management, enhance customer experiences, and personalize marketing strategies. The adaptability of these tools underscores their importance in today’s data-driven world, providing tailored solutions to industry-specific challenges.

Challenges and Considerations

Despite its advantages, implementing data analytics software comes with challenges. One significant concern is data privacy and security, as handling sensitive information requires strict compliance with regulations. Additionally, integrating analytics tools with existing systems can be complex and costly. Organizations must also ensure their teams are adequately trained to use these tools effectively. Addressing these challenges involves careful planning, selecting the right software that aligns with organizational goals, and investing in staff training to maximize the benefits of analytics solutions.
